Tentativo di applicazione dell'aggiornamento OPatch 11.2.x non riuscito
Problema: il tentativo di applicazione dell'aggiornamento Opatch restituisce il seguente errore:
.\ApplyUpdate.ps1 : File C:\Users\11.2.19.0-Update-Win\11.2.19.0-Update-Win\ApplyUpdate.ps1 cannot be loaded. The file C:\Users\11.2.19.0-Update-Win\11.2.19.0-Update-Win\ApplyUpdate.ps1 is not digitally signed. You cannot run this script on the current system. For more information about running scripts and setting execution policy, see about_Execution_Policies at https:/go.microsoft.com/fwlink/?LinkID=135170. At line:1 char:1 + .\ApplyUpdate.ps1 C:\Oracle\Middleware + ~~~~~~~~~~~~~~~~~ + CategoryInfo: SecurityError:(:)[],PSSecurityException + FullyQualifiedErrorId : UnauthorizedAccess
Soluzione:
Set-ExecutionPolicy -Scope Process -ExecutionPolicy BypassLe regole di Oracle Hyperion Calculation Manager con Java non funzionano dopo l'aggiornamento
Sintomo: questo problema è stato rilevato nelle versioni da 11.2.16 a 11.2.19.
Soluzione: per risolvere il problema, effettuare le operazioni riportate di seguito.
CALCMGRCDF.JAR dalla posizione di origine:
MWH\EPMSystem11R1\products\Essbase\EssbaseServer\java\udf\CALCMGRCDF.JAR
MWH\essbase\products\Essbase\EssbaseServer\java\udf\calcmgrcdf.jar
Nota:
Questo problema è stato risolto nella release 11.2.20.Errori dopo l'esecuzione di un aggiornamento sul posto dalla release 11.2.6 alla 11.2.8
Problema: nella release 11.2.8 di EPM System, dopo l'esecuzione di un aggiornamento sul posto dalla release 11.2.6 alla 11.2.8, si verifica un errore in Active Directory configurato in modalità SSL e viene visualizzato il messaggio EPMCSS-05138:Failed to validate Security configuration. Failed to connect. Invalid values for host or port. Enter a valid value(s). Anche il file SharedServices_Security.log contiene il messaggio di errore seguente:
[SRC_CLASS: com.hyperion.css.spi.util.jndi.GenericJNDIHelper] [SRC_METHOD: getLookUpContext] THROW[[EPMCSS-05811: Failed to validate directory configuration.MSADSSL Error connecting to host. RootCause : simple bind failed: <AD host name>:636. Verify LDAP user directory configuration. Nested Exception:javax.naming.CommunicationException: simple bind failed: <AD host name>:636 [Root exception is jav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target]
Lo scenario precedente indica che si verifica un errore di handshake SSL tra FoundationServices0 e Active Directory ed è impossibile individuare il certificato di Active Directory anche se è distribuito nella posizione indicata di seguito come previsto dal documento.
<ORACLE_MIDDLEWARE>\jdk\jre
Tuttavia, in 11.2.8 FoundationServices0, java.home fa riferimento alla posizione indicata di seguito, ed è quindi impossibile elaborare il certificato. Viene visualizzata un'eccezione SSLHandshakeException:
<ORACLE_MIDDLEWARE>\jdk\java
Soluzione:
keytool -import -alias ******** -keystore <ORACLE_MIDDLEWARE>\jdk\java\lib\security\cacerts -trustcacerts -storepass password -file <ORACLE_MIDDLEWARE>\jdk\java\lib\security\******.crt
Nota:
A partire dalla release 11.2.8, questo non è applicabile perché la cartella<ORACLE_MIDDLEWARE>\jdk\java non è più disponibile.keytool -import -alias ******** -keystore <ORACLE_MIDDLEWARE>\jdk\jre\lib\security\cacerts -trustcacerts -storepass password -file <ORACLE_MIDDLEWARE>\jdk\jre\lib\security\security\******.crtErrore dei task di installazione per Applica aggiornamento o Reinstalla
Problema: tutti i task di installazione generano un errore per Applica aggiornamento o Reinstalla.
Si verificano errori nelle operazioni InstallShield. Il registro InstallShield VPD potrebbe essere danneggiato e potrebbe essere visualizzato l'errore seguente:
ERRORE: ismpEngine-install-stderr.log,com.installshield.database.EmptyResultException: Empty result [SELECT Publicly_SharedFROM Installed_Software_ObjectWHERE Installed_Software_Object_Id=? ]at com.installshield.database.SQLProcessor.queryBoolean(Unknown Source)
Soluzione:
Middleware_Home\EPMSystem11R1\_vpddb, ad esempio in Middleware_Home\EPMSystem11R1\_vpddb_backup.Verrà rigenerato il registro VPD.
Installazione di Oracle HTTP Server durante l'aggiornamento su Linux
Problema: impossibile installare Oracle HTTP Server durante l'aggiornamento su Linux.
Soluzione: se si riceve un messaggio di errore durante l'installazione di Oracle HTTP Server mentre si esegue l'aggiornamento su Linux, controllare i file Inventory.xml e Comp.xml in \ContentsXML nella cartella inventory per verificare che i file non contengano collegamenti simbolici. Se presenti, sostituirli con l'indirizzo fisico.
Aggiornamento di FDMEE
Problema: quando si eseguono gli script di aggiornamento di FDMEE, potrebbe verificarsi l'errore riportato di seguito.
aif_migrate.dtsx per MS SQL o aif_import.par per Oracle
Soluzione: controllare il sistema e verificare che FDMEE del sistema di origine sia stato corretto nella Release 11.1.2.4 220. Quella patch prevedeva numerose modifiche al repository che devono essere applicate prima dell'aggiornamento alla Release 11.2, soprattutto se si rilevano numerosi errori sulla lunghezza delle colonne.
Errori durante l'aggiornamento di Financial Close Management o Tax Governance alla Release 11.2
Problema: Durante l'importazione dello schema della release 11.1.2.4 nello schema della release 11.2, viene visualizzato l'errore riportato di seguito.
ORA-39083: Creazione dell'object type INDEX_STATISTICS non riuscita con l'errore: ORA-01403: dati non trovati ORA-01403: dati non trovati. SQL in errore: DECLARE IND_NAME VARCHAR2(60); IND_OWNER VARCHAR2(60); BEGIN DELETE FROM "SYS"."IMPDP_STATS"; SELECT index_name, index_owner INTO IND_NAME, IND_OWNER FROM (SELECT UNIQUE sgc1.index_name, sgc1.index_owner, COUNT(*) mycount FROM sys.ku$_find_sgc_view sgc1, TABLE (sgc1.col_list) myc
Soluzione: è possibile ignorare questo errore.
Problema di avvio del server Financial Close Management o Tax Governance dopo l'aggiornamento alla Release 11.2
Problema: se si hanno difficoltà ad avviare i server dopo l'aggiornamento alla release 11.2, il problema potrebbe essere una differenza di nomi di dominio.
Soluzione: modificare le tabelle denominate WL_LLR_FINANCIALCLOSE0 colonna REDCORDSTR da <Dominio_precedente>//FinancialClose0 a EPMSystem//FinancialClose0 (nome predefinito). La stessa modifica è necessaria in WL_LLR_TAXMANAGEMENT0. Entrambi gli ambienti, di origine e target, devono essere identici, anche per il nome di dominio. Se gli ambienti sono identici, questo problema non si verifica.